Patents by Inventor Jorge Moraleda

Jorge Moraleda has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20120173504
    Abstract: The present invention relies on the two-dimensional information in documents and encodes two-dimensional structures into a one-dimensional synthetic language such that two-dimensional documents can be searched at text search speed. The system comprises: an indexing module, a retrieval module, an encoder, a quantization module, a retrieval engine and a control module coupled by a bus. Electronic documents are first indexed by the indexing module and stored as a synthetic text library. The retrieval module then converts an input image to synthetic text and searches for matches to the synthetic text in the synthetic text library. The matches can be in turn used to retrieve the corresponding electronic documents. In one or more embodiments, the present invention includes a method for comparing the synthetic text to documents that have been converted to synthetic text for a match.
    Type: Application
    Filed: March 8, 2012
    Publication date: July 5, 2012
    Inventor: Jorge Moraleda
  • Patent number: 8201076
    Abstract: An MMR system for publ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it, and an MMR publisher. A computer includes a document authoring application, plug-in, and printer driver.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The list of results and links are sent back to the MMR gateway for presentation on the mobile device. The present invention also includes a number of novel methods including a method for capturing symbolic information from documents and for capturing printer dll functions.
    Type: Grant
    Filed: October 17, 2008
    Date of Patent: June 12, 2012
    Assignee: Ricoh Co., Ltd.
    Inventors: Jonathan J. Hull, Berna Erol, Jamey Graham, Jorge Moraleda, Ichiro Sakikawa, Daniel G. Van Olst
  • Patent number: 8176054
    Abstract: The present invention relies on the two-dimensional information in documents and encodes two-dimensional structures into a one-dimensional synthetic language such that two-dimensional documents can be searched at text search speed. The system comprises: an indexing module, a retrieval module, an encoder, a quantization module, a retrieval engine and a control module coupled by a bus. A number of electronic documents are first indexed by the indexing module and stored as a synthetic text library. The retrieval module then converts and input image to synthetic text and searches for matches to the synthetic text in the synthetic text library. The matches can be in turn used to retrieve the corresponding electronic documents. It should be noted that a plurality of matches and corresponding electronic documents may be retrieves ranked by order according the similarity of the synthetic text.
    Type: Grant
    Filed: July 12, 2007
    Date of Patent: May 8, 2012
    Assignee: Ricoh Co. Ltd
    Inventor: Jorge Moraleda
  • Patent number: 8156115
    Abstract: A Mixed Media Reality (MMR) system and associated techniques are disclosed. The MMR system provides mechanisms for forming a mixed media document that includes media of at least two types (e.g., printed paper as a first medium and digital content and/or web link as a second medium). The present invention provides a system, method, and computer program product for modifying tie strength between members of an existing network using captured digital images of documents. Documents associated with the captured images are recognized and other members associated with the document are determined. Using this information, ties between members or the network are modified.
    Type: Grant
    Filed: March 31, 2008
    Date of Patent: April 10, 2012
    Assignee: Ricoh Co. Ltd.
    Inventors: Berna Erol, Jonathan J. Hull, Hidenobu Kishi, Qifa Ke, Jorge Moraleda
  • Publication number: 20120054112
    Abstract: Techniques for performing a task while preserving the privacy or confidentiality of information used as input for the task. In one embodiment the task is broken down into smaller tasks (called subtasks or microtasks), which are then outsourced. The input information for each microtask is based upon and is generally a subset of the input information received for the task. The determination of microtasks for the task is performed in such a manner that constraints associated with the task are satisfied. For example, microtasks may be determined for the task based upon risk (e.g., the risk associated with the privacy or confidentiality of the input information being compromised as a result of the outsourcing), quality constraints (e.g., desired quality of the work product resulting from performance of the task), cost constraints, and other constraints associated with the job.
    Type: Application
    Filed: August 30, 2010
    Publication date: March 1, 2012
    Applicant: Ricoh Company, Ltd.
    Inventors: Michael J. Gormish, Berna Erol, Jorge Moraleda, Timothee Bailloeul, Xu Liu, David G. Stork
  • Publication number: 20120053992
    Abstract: Techniques for pricing a task are provided. The pricing may be based on attributes of the input information and one or more rules determined for the input information. The rules may be based on one or more variables and customer-specified constraints.
    Type: Application
    Filed: August 30, 2010
    Publication date: March 1, 2012
    Applicant: Ricoh Company, Ltd.
    Inventors: Berna Erol, Michael J. Gormish, Jorge Moraleda, Timothee Bailloeul, Xu Liu, David G. Stork
  • Patent number: 8073263
    Abstract: A MMR system that uses multiple classifiers for predicting, monitoring, and adjusting index tables for image recognition comprises a plurality of mobile devices, a pre-processing server or MMR gateway, and an MMR matching unit, and may include an MMR publisher. The MMR matching unit includes a plurality of recognition unit and index table pairs corresponding to classifiers to be applied to received image queries, as well as an image registration unit for storing and monitoring performance data for the classifiers. The MMR matching unit receives the image query and identifies, using a classifier set, a result including a document, the page, and the location on the page corresponding to the image query. The present invention also includes methods for monitoring online performance of a multiple classifier image recognition system, for classifier selection and comparison, and for offline classifier prediction.
    Type: Grant
    Filed: October 7, 2008
    Date of Patent: December 6, 2011
    Assignee: Ricoh Co., Ltd.
    Inventors: Jonathan J. Hull, Berna Erol, Jorge Moraleda
  • Publication number: 20100329574
    Abstract: A system and method for indexing and retrieval of document images in an MMR system having repeated content is described. The system provides one or more hierarchical shared content indices that produce faster and/or more accurate search results. The system is also advantageous because the number and configuration of the hierarchical shared content indices is automated, scalable and efficient for processing documents with partially repeated content. In particular, the MMR matching unit includes a hierarchical shared content index (HSCI) and associated methods of use for processing images where the MMR system includes repeated content.
    Type: Application
    Filed: June 24, 2009
    Publication date: December 30, 2010
    Inventors: Jorge Moraleda, Jonathan J. Hull, Kurt W. Piersol
  • Publication number: 20090100048
    Abstract: An MMR system for publ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it and an MMR publisher integrated into a network with an advertiser, an ad broker, and an MMR service bureau.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The MMR service bureau uses the result to retrieve advertising or other links associated with the location on the page. The list of results and links are sent back to the MMR gateway for presentation on the mobile device. The present invention also includes a number of novel methods including a differentially weighting links associated with an MMR document.
    Type: Application
    Filed: October 17, 2008
    Publication date: April 16, 2009
    Inventors: Jonathan J. Hull, Berna Erol, Jorge Moraleda
  • Publication number: 20090100050
    Abstract: The mobile device includes a client that has a number of modules, and the MMR Gateway and MMR matching unit are implemented as a server that has a number of modules. The implementation of the MMR system as a client and a server is advantageous because the modules may be distributed among the client and the server in a variety of configurations. The present invention includes a capture module, a preprocessing module, a feature extraction module, a retrieval module, a send message module, an action module, a prediction module, a feedback module, a sending module, an MMR database, a streaming module, an e-mail module, a voice recognition system and an audio database. These modules and systems are operational upon the client or the server. In one embodiment, the client includes only the capture module with the remaining modules operational on the server. In a second embodiment, the server includes the action module with the remaining modules operational on the client.
    Type: Application
    Filed: December 19, 2008
    Publication date: April 16, 2009
    Inventors: Berna Erol, Jorge Moraleda, Jonathan J. Hull
  • Publication number: 20090100334
    Abstract: An MMR system for publ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it, and an MMR publisher. A computer includes a document authoring application, plug-in, and printer driver.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The list of results and links are sent back to the MMR gateway for presentation on the mobile device. The present invention also includes a number of novel methods including a method for capturing symbolic information from documents and for capturing printer dll functions.
    Type: Application
    Filed: October 17, 2008
    Publication date: April 16, 2009
    Inventors: Jonathan J. Hull, Berna Erol, Jamey Graham, Jorge Moraleda, Ichiro Sakikawa, Daniel G. Van Olst
  • Publication number: 20090092287
    Abstract: An MMR system integrating image tracking and recognition comprises a plurality of mobile devices, a pre-processing server or MMR gateway, and an MMR matching unit, and may include an MMR publisher. The MMR matching unit receives an image query from the pre-processing server or M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page, and the location on the page. Image tracking information also is provided for determining relative locations of images within a document page. The mobile device includes an image tracker for providing at least a portion of the image tracking information. The present invention also includes methods for image tracking-assisted recognition, recognition of multiple images using a single image query, and improved image tracking using MMR recognition.
    Type: Application
    Filed: October 7, 2008
    Publication date: April 9, 2009
    Inventors: Jorge Moraleda, Berna Erol, Jonathan J. Hull
  • Publication number: 20090080800
    Abstract: An MMR system for processing image queries across index tables with unequal priority comprises a plurality of mobile devices, a pre-processing server or MMR gateway, and an MMR matching unit, and may include an MMR publisher. The MMR matching unit receives an image query from the pre-processing server or M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page, and the location on the page. The MMR matching unit includes a dispatcher, a plurality of recognition units, and index tables, as well as an image registration unit. In one embodiment, the system includes an MMR matching plug-in installed on the mobile device. The present invention also includes methods for processing image queries across index tables of unequal priority and updating a high priority index based on received or projected image queries.
    Type: Application
    Filed: September 29, 2008
    Publication date: March 26, 2009
    Inventors: Jorge Moraleda, Berna Erol, Jonathan J. Hull
  • Publication number: 20090076996
    Abstract: A MMR system that uses multiple classifiers for predicting, monitoring, and adjusting index tables for image recognition comprises a plurality of mobile devices, a pre-processing server or MMR gateway, and an MMR matching unit, and may include an MMR publisher. The MMR matching unit includes a plurality of recognition unit and index table pairs corresponding to classifiers to be applied to received image queries, as well as an image registration unit for storing and monitoring performance data for the classifiers. The MMR matching unit receives the image query and identifies, using a classifier set, a result including a document, the page, and the location on the page corresponding to the image query. The present invention also includes methods for monitoring online performance of a multiple classifier image recognition system, for classifier selection and comparison, and for offline classifier prediction.
    Type: Application
    Filed: October 7, 2008
    Publication date: March 19, 2009
    Inventors: Jonathan J. Hull, Berna Erol, Jorge Moraleda
  • Publication number: 20090074300
    Abstract: A MMR system for newspaper publ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it and an MMR publisher.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The image registration unit includes an indexing unit for generating images adapted to the environment and capabilities of the image capture device. The indexing unit also automatically adapts the configuration of the plurality of recognition units and index tables based upon image queries applied to the plurality of recognition and index tables. The plurality of recognition units and index tables are configured based on content they reference, recognition algorithm used or other factors.
    Type: Application
    Filed: September 15, 2008
    Publication date: March 19, 2009
    Inventors: Jonathan J. Hull, Berna Erol, Jorge Moraleda
  • Publication number: 20090070110
    Abstract: A MMR system for newspaper publ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it and an MMR publisher.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The MMR matching unit also includes a result combiner coupled to each of the recognition units to receive recognition results. The result combiner produces a list of most likely results and associated confidence scores. This list of results is sent by the result combiner back to the MMR gateway for presentation on the mobile device. The result combiner uses the quality predictor as an input in deciding which results are best. The present invention also includes a number of novel methods including a method for generating the list of best results.
    Type: Application
    Filed: September 15, 2008
    Publication date: March 12, 2009
    Inventors: Berna Erol, Jonathan J. Hull, Jorge Moraleda
  • Publication number: 20090067726
    Abstract: A MMR system for newspaper publ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it and an MMR publisher.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The MMR system also includes a quality predictor as a plug-in installed on the mobile device to filter images before they are included as part of a retrieval request or as part of the MMR matching unit. The quality predictor comprises an input for receiving recognition algorithm information, a vector calculator, a score generator and a scoring module. The quality predictor receives as inputs an image query, context information and device parameters, and generates an outputs a recognizability score. The present invention also includes a method for generating robustness features.
    Type: Application
    Filed: September 15, 2008
    Publication date: March 12, 2009
    Inventors: Berna Erol, Emilio R. Antunez, Landry Huet, Jonathan J. Hull, Jorge Moraleda
  • Publication number: 20090070415
    Abstract: A MMR system for publishing comprises a plurality of mobile devices, an MMR gateway, an MMR matching unit and an MMR publisher. The mobile devices send retrieval requests including image queries and other contextual information. The MMR gateway processes the retrieval request from the mobile devices and then generates an image query that is passed on to the MMR matching unit. The MMR matching unit receives an image query from the M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The MMR matching unit includes an image registration unit that receives new content from the MMR publisher and updates the index table of the MMR matching unit. A method for automatically registering images and other data with the MMR matching unit, a method for dynamic load balancing and a method for image-feature-based queue ordering are also included.
    Type: Application
    Filed: September 15, 2008
    Publication date: March 12, 2009
    Inventors: Hidenobu Kishi, Sadao Takahashi, Takahiro Furukawa, Berna Erol, Jonathan J. Hull, Jorge Moraleda, Jamey Graham
  • Publication number: 20090070302
    Abstract: An MMR system for searching across multiple indexes comprises a plurality of mobile devices, a pre-processing server or MMR gateway, and an MMR matching unit, and may include an MMR publisher. The MMR matching unit receives an image query from the pre-processing server or MMR gateway and sends it to one or more of the recognition units to identify a result including a document, the page and the location on the page. The MMR matching unit includes a segmenter for segmenting received images by content type, a distributor for distributing the images to corresponding content type index tables, and an integrator for integrating recognition results. The result is returned to the mobile device via the pre-processing server or MMR gateway. The present invention also includes a number of novel methods including a method for processing content-type specific image queries and for processing queries across multiple indexes.
    Type: Application
    Filed: September 29, 2008
    Publication date: March 12, 2009
    Inventors: Jorge Moraleda, Berna Erol, Jonathan J. Hull
  • Publication number: 20090018990
    Abstract: The present invention relies on the two-dimensional information in documents and encodes two-dimensional structures into a one-dimensional synthetic language such that two-dimensional documents can be searched at text search speed. The system comprises: an indexing module, a retrieval module, an encoder, a quantization module, a retrieval engine and a control module coupled by a bus. A number of electronic documents are first indexed by the indexing module and stored as a synthetic text library. The retrieval module then converts and input image to synthetic text and searches for matches to the synthetic text in the synthetic text library. The matches can be in turn used to retrieve the corresponding electronic documents. It should be noted that a plurality of matches and corresponding electronic documents may be retrieves ranked by order according the similarity of the synthetic text.
    Type: Application
    Filed: July 12, 2007
    Publication date: January 15, 2009
    Inventor: Jorge Moraleda